博客專欄

        EEPW首頁 > 博客 > 迅為4412開發板QtE4.7和Qtopia的切換

        迅為4412開發板QtE4.7和Qtopia的切換

        發布人:daybydayi 時間:2020-09-22 來源:工程師 發布文章

        1.設置開發板優先運行的文件系統
        源代碼編譯后,默認是運行 Qtopia,下面講一下如何直接運行 QtE4.7。
        這里需要修改“root/etc/init.d/rcS”文件。如下圖所示,打開“root/etc/init.d/rcS”文件。

        打開文件“rcS”后,進入文件中的最后一行,如下圖所示,這是源碼的狀態,系統啟動
        后,會默認運行"qtopia"。

        如果要默認啟動“qt-4.7.1”,則將修改為上圖中的“qtopia”修改為“qt4”,如下圖
        所示。注意這里的修改語法和格式一定要和源代碼的的一樣。

        修改后,重新編譯生成二進制文件,系統就會默認運行 Qt/E4.7。

        2.QtE4.7 和 Qtopia2.2.0 的觸摸校準
        如果用戶燒寫鏡像后,第一次運行正常,斷電重啟后,文件系統出現如下圖的錯誤。這是
        由于開機后“校準文件為空”。

        出現上圖中的錯誤,則需要在超級終端中,輸入命令“rm -rf /etc/point*”,然后輸入
        命令“reboot”重啟開發板,如下圖所示。

        如上圖,重啟后就可以重新校準。
        為了避免這個錯誤,用戶需要在文件系統的校準階段,按照屏幕界面“十字”標識,依次
        點擊標識。這個過程就是觸摸屏的校準階段,確保校準的每一次都是按在系統指示的位置。
        3. 系統運行后 QtE4.7 和 Qtopia2.2.0 的切換
        輸入切換命令的時候如果已經打開過一個文件系統,則需要先關閉已啟動文件系統的進程。
        下面舉例說明,如何關閉文件系統的進程。
        如下圖,已經運行了 Qtopia2.2.0 文件系統。

        如下圖,輸入命令“ps”,查看系統進程。

        如下圖,使用 kill 命令將 Qtopia2.2.0 的進程關掉

        然后輸入切換命令“qt4”,就可以切換到 Qt/E4.7。
        Qt/E4.7 文件系統啟動后,再切換到 Qtopia2.2.0,也是使用和上面類似的方法,這里就
        不再重復講解了。

        *博客內容為網友個人發布,僅代表博主個人觀點,如有侵權請聯系工作人員刪除。

        電子血壓計相關文章:電子血壓計原理




        關鍵詞:

        相關推薦

        技術專區

        關閉
        主站蜘蛛池模板: 县级市| 肇州县| 庄浪县| 自贡市| 江城| 馆陶县| 大连市| 五原县| 岐山县| 福安市| 兴海县| 牙克石市| 阳东县| 峨边| 靖安县| 乐业县| 塘沽区| 周宁县| 霍林郭勒市| 怀集县| 米林县| 邵阳市| 高密市| 兴城市| 弥渡县| 宁南县| 湘阴县| 南昌县| 基隆市| 会泽县| 民县| 罗城| 西畴县| 东丽区| 宜州市| 涞源县| 思南县| 陇西县| 云和县| 南阳市| 梁山县|